**Wanted: Senior Digital Content Specialist**
Supporting the Design and Production Manager, the Senior Digital Content Specialist is responsible for supporting the promotion of Rotorua Lakes Council through visual story-telling using a variety of audio visual and photography methods. This includes creating content to support behaviour change and educational awareness.
Despite the rumours, life at Rotorua Lakes Council is never dull. We are a large and busy organisation, so the ability to handle a variety of competing priorities and reactive jobs is a must. There is always plenty going on and there will be lots of opportunities for the right person to flex some creative muscle.
Working alongside two Senior Designers, a Digital Media Production Specialist and an Animator, you will help Council reach a range of audiences with engaging, effective visual communications using strategies as your road map; confectionery as bait and coffee for the occasional bribe along the way.
The ability to handle a variety of competing priorities and reactive jobs is a must (check out the job description for more on this), as is the flexibility to work outside of office hours as required.
In return for your skills and experience you will be supported by a strong, diverse and fun team including specialists across media, communications, digital, animation, marketing, and design.
**Our preferred team mate will have**:
- Blood type: Creative
- Demonstrable hands-on digital creative development experience and a passion for storytelling excellence.
- Relevant experience (3+ years) in the digital creative space, especially videography and photography
- Relevant tertiary qualification (B.Creative Tech or similar)
- Excellence in delivering client focussed outcomes with the ability to explain to clients how a brief has been interpreted, including a demonstrated ability to storyboard
- The ability to manage a job from concept through to delivery of final product
- Proven experience in and highly proficient with Adobe Creative Cloud - particularly Photoshop and Premiere Pro. Design skills a bonus.
- In-depth knowledge of pre and post-production processes
- Solid understanding of social networking sites and digital marketing tools.
- 101 UAV and 102 UAV qualified (or desire to obtain these)
- A keen interest in the workings of local and/or central government; and the Rotorua community
- A genuine team mind-set - we look out for each other and are a close knit team
Te Kaunihera o nga Roto o Rotorua (Rotorua Lakes Council) is committed to biculturalism and working in partnership with Te Arawa, our local iwi. We value staff who have an openness and appreciation of Maori values, te reo and tikanga Maori.
